Kajabi is designed to be user-friendly. Most people can build products, pages, and email sequences without technical assistance.

The more important question is whether the way your Kajabi account is structured supports how you plan to sell, market, and deliver your offers.

This decision is rarely about technical skill. It is about business architecture.

What Most People Successfully Build on Their Own

When starting out, most users create the visible components of their business:

  • A product

  • A checkout page

  • An opt-in form

  • A few landing pages

  • Basic email automation

Kajabi makes these elements accessible. Many people complete this phase independently.

The challenge does not usually appear in building features. It appears in evaluating whether those features are connected strategically.

Two Kajabi accounts can contain identical tools and generate very different results depending on how offers, pricing tiers, and customer flow are structured.

Where Doubt Usually Begins

Uncertainty does not show up as broken buttons or missing settings.

It shows up in questions such as:

  • Does this setup support multiple offers?

  • Will adding a new product disrupt automation?

  • Should this be an offer, a product, or an access group?

  • Is my email sequence aligned with my pricing structure?

  • Why are conversions lower than expected?

At this stage, the platform functions correctly. The concern shifts from usage to alignment.

When Setting Up Kajabi Yourself Makes Sense

Handling your own setup is practical when:

  • You are still defining your offer

  • Pricing is not finalized

  • You are testing ideas

  • You are not actively running traffic

  • Your primary goal is learning the platform

In early experimentation phases, rebuilding later is normal and manageable.

If structural changes will happen frequently, hiring help too early may slow iteration.

When Hiring a Kajabi Expert Becomes Valuable

Professional guidance becomes more useful when:

  • Your pricing and delivery model are finalized

  • You are preparing to run paid traffic

  • You plan to launch publicly

  • Your automation feels complicated

  • Multiple offers need to connect cleanly

  • You want an audit of what already exists

At this stage, the focus shifts from building to optimizing.

An experienced Kajabi consultant evaluates:

  • Offer structure

  • Funnel alignment

  • Email sequencing logic

  • Product hierarchy

  • Access Group configuration

  • Checkout flow

  • Long-term scalability

The goal is structural integrity, not adding features.

DIY vs Expert Support: A Structural Comparison

Setting up Kajabi yourself focuses on execution.
Hiring help focuses on architecture.

Execution builds pages.
Architecture builds systems.

If your account feels busy but not cohesive, the issue is usually structural rather than technical.

The Cost of Rebuilding Later

Revisions become more disruptive after:

  • Multiple email sequences are live

  • Affiliates are promoting

  • Paid ads are active

  • Members are enrolled

  • Automations are layered

Restructuring at that point can require undoing significant work.

Getting strategic input before scale often prevents rework.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I set up Kajabi myself and get help later?

Yes. Many people build independently and then hire an expert for a review or optimization phase. In most cases, the work involves refining structure rather than rebuilding from scratch.

What does a Kajabi expert actually do?

A Kajabi expert evaluates whether your account supports your sales process, pricing structure, automation logic, and delivery model. This often includes auditing products, funnels, tags, email flows, and checkout configuration.

Is hiring help only necessary for large businesses?

No. Smaller businesses often benefit from structural guidance early because small misalignments can affect conversions significantly.

Do I need help before or after launching?

Both options are valid. Some hire support before launching to confirm alignment. Others seek help after launch when structural friction becomes visible.

How to Make the Decision

Ask yourself:

  • Am I building features or building a system?

  • Is my current setup aligned with how I plan to sell?

  • If I add a new offer, will it integrate smoothly?

  • Do I feel confident about how buyers move through my ecosystem?

If the answers feel uncertain, the issue is likely structural rather than technical.

Kajabi is approachable. Strategic alignment is where experience becomes valuable.
